Okimi Miltenberg Restaurant

Sushi restaurant on Miltenberg's main street offering Asian dishes with — according to guests — a lot of handmade preparation and a view of the Main.

Okimi is a sushi restaurant in Miltenberg that serves sushi along with a range of other Asian dishes.

Cuisine and Menu

The menu features sushi as well as a variety of Asian dishes. According to guests, the offerings go beyond what many other Asian restaurants provide. Several diners note that much of the food is prepared by hand, with little reliance on convenience products. Dishes mentioned repeatedly by visitors include grilled dumplings, Barbary duck, banana cake with vanilla sauce, and the Okimi iced tea; homemade lemonades are also mentioned.

Atmosphere

Visitors describe a quiet setting with relaxing music and report a view of the Main. These impressions come from guest reviews and reflect personal perceptions. According to guests, reservations are possible depending on the day and time, though not strictly necessary.
